Melton RFC bid to halt title challengers

Melton RFC First XV return to the main business of the Midlands One East league on Saturday as they entertain promotion-chasing Old Northamptonians.

It’s the latest in a cluster of tough fixtures for Gareth Collins’ side against the league’s top teams.

Melton edged to a 15-12 win last time out at Northampton Old Scouts, but they will be hoping to improve on the last home game when leaders Newbold swept them away in the second half in a 34-14 defeat.

Old Northamptonians sit second in the table, four points adrift of the leaders, and won the reverse fixture 25-5 back in October.

The visitors have lost just three times this season, but came unstuck at third-placed Kettering last month.

They will arrive at Burton Road, however, on the back of a three-game winning streak. Kick-off is 2.15pm and all support is welcome.
